S12 in Sheffield has demonstrated stronger rental dynamics than capital appreciation over the past five years, with rents growing at 6.1% compound annual rate compared to property prices at 1.9%. The district's trajectory score of 59.7/100 places it at the 92nd percentile nationally, indicating above-average market fundamentals despite modest price growth. Population expansion of 1.2% over five years suggests steady demographic support. The area is classified at the latent stage of gentrification, indicating early-stage development characteristics without yet experiencing the pronounced transformation seen in more advanced stages. These metrics collectively suggest a market where yield-focused investors may find opportunities, though capital growth remains constrained relative to rent generation.

What is the average house price in Sheffield?
The average property price in Sheffield (S12) is £212k as of January 2026, based on UK House Price Index data. Prices have grown at 1.6% per year over the last five years.
What is the average rent in Sheffield?
The median monthly rent in Sheffield (S12) is £916 (2026), based on ONS private rental data.
